The Keri Caves are among the most iconic sights, with their large caverns and natural spring caves. As the boat glides through the caves, the reflected sunlight on the waters makes for stunning visuals. The swimming stop here lasts about 35 minutes, giving ample time to snorkel, take photos, and enjoy the serene waters. For those who love water activities, snorkeling equipment is included, allowing underwater exploration of the marine life in the area.

Marathonisi, also known as Turtle Island, is a highlight of the tour. Shaped like a mother turtle, this island is a key nesting site for sea turtles. The stop here lasts about 35 minutes, giving plenty of time to sunbathe on its beautiful northern beach, swim, or grab a cold drink from a floating bar. The island’s natural beauty and its significance as a nesting ground make it a meaningful stop for wildlife lovers.
